USB devices

It is recommended to connect the USB Flash Memory to the TV's USB
ports directly.
Some USB devices or USB HUB may not be used with this TV.
You cannot connect any devices using a USB card reader.

USB Flash Memory
(for playing back in Media Player)
USB Flash Memory format:
FAT16, FAT32 or exFAT
USB HDDs formatted on a PC are not guaranteed to work in Media Player.

Photo format

Supported Photo formats
JPEG (.jpg, .jpeg, .mpo)
Image resolution (pixel):
8 × 8 to 30,719 × 17,279
Sub-sampling:
4:4:4, 4:2:2, 4:2:0
DCF and EXIF standards
Progressive JPEG is not supported.
= Note =
Some files may not be played back even if they fulfil these conditions.
Do not use two-byte characters or other special codes for file names.
Connected devices may become unusable with this TV if the file or folder
names are changed.
